Cultural-Natural Reservation “Old Orhei”
Old Orhei is a remarkable archaeological and cultural complex located in central Moldova, about 45 minutes from Chișinău, in the village of Butuceni, Orhei District. It is an emblematic site that combines history, nature, and spirituality, being part of the Cultural-Natural Reservation “Old Orhei”.
The complex is situated on a rocky promontory along the Răut River, offering spectacular views. Visitors can explore:
-
The rock-hewn monastery in Butuceni, still active today, with churches carved into the cliffs.
-
The Church of the Assumption of the Virgin Mary, built in 1636, located on a hill with a panoramic view.
-
The Tatar Baths, remnants of medieval bathhouses mentioned in documents from the 16th–17th centuries.
-
Grottos and monastic cells, used as places of worship and spiritual retreat.
